Brainard Bids Adieu
Carmel Mayor Jim Brainard shocked the Indiana political landscape this week when he announced he would not seek another term. Mayor since 1996, Brainard oversaw massive growth in the city’s population, infrastructure and amenities. Along the way, he sparked controversy and debate about the role of municipal government, and the amount of debt they should be willing to take on. On this week’s Statehouse Happenings, Rob Kendall and Abdul-Hakim Shabazz discuss Brainard’s legacy.
